I love Actus's work. I started with Return of the Runebound Professor, then started reading Rise of the Living Forge and Nightmare Realm Summoner. How he manages to keep updating all three of them several times a week is beyond me.

To answer your question: I'm really enjoying it and am current with the latest release on Royal Road. The magic system is fairly unique in that you have to acquire 7 runes at each tier of power and you can tier up a rune by combining all seven into the next tier. The rune types and intent can alter what type of rune you end up with.

The MC has some fun powers and always goes for rune types that are fun to follow and see him use. Plus he actually acts as a professor and teaches magic, which isn't very common in the genre. There's a decent-sized supporting cast as well that expands throughout the story.
